Closet demolition services involve the careful removal of existing closet structures, including shelving, rods, doors, and walls, to prepare a space for renovation or redesign. These services are typically performed by experienced contractors who can efficiently and safely dismantle built-in or standalone closets, minimizing disruption to the surrounding areas. Whether a homeowner wants to create a larger walk-in closet, eliminate outdated storage spaces, or clear the way for new organizational systems, professional closet demolition ensures the work is done cleanly and correctly.
Many property owners turn to closet demolition services to address specific problems such as cramped or inefficient storage, damaged or moldy closet components, or the need to reconfigure a room’s layout. For example, an older home might have closets that no longer meet the needs of modern storage, or a property may require removing outdated fixtures to make space for custom cabinetry or new flooring. These services help solve clutter issues, improve room flow, and create a more functional living environment, especially when planning a comprehensive renovation.

The overview below groups typical Closet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Terre Haute,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or closet demolition work in Terre Haute range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ects fall within this middle range, covering tasks like removing shelving or small sections of drywall.
Partial Demolition - For larger, more involved partial demolitions,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. Projects in this range might include removing built-in units or multiple closet sections.
Full Closet Removal - Complete demolition of an entire closet usually costs between $1,500 and $3,500, depending on size and complexity.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which is common for larger or more detailed demolitions.
Full Replacement - When a closet is being fully removed and replaced, costs can range from $3,500 to $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this, but most fall into the middle tiers based on scope and materials invol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What does closet demolition involve? Closet demolition typically includes removing existing closet structures, such as shelving, rods, and walls, to prepare the space for renovation or new installations.
Are there different types of closet demolition services? Yes, services can range from partial removal of specific components to complete teardown of the entire closet area, depending on the project needs.
How can local contractors assist with closet demolition? Local contractors can evaluate the space, safely remove old closet components, and prepare the area for remodeling or new storage solutions.
Is it necessary to get permits for closet dem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; a local service provider can advise on whether permits are needed for your project in Terre Haute, IN.
What should I consider before hiring a closet demolition service? Consider the scope of the demolition, the experience of the service provider, and their ability to handle the specific requirements of your space.
